Transaction 4648686d284fa2c870ab32c1611ef16c05c1e2ea2f61a03534a357c3c4bd53e7
1 Input
2 Outputs
- 4648686d284fa2c870ab32c1611ef16c05c1e2ea2f61a03534a357c3c4bd53e7:0
- 4648686d284fa2c870ab32c1611ef16c05c1e2ea2f61a03534a357c3c4bd53e7:1
value 658800
address 1JQvx15XtSeFrugx4L9JB89Joykw8PTGLW
value 3535674
address 17t3KBQNq2FoDSWzBGegWWrerZtjGdMHbJ